Mayagüez is the largest city on the Western side of the island of Puerto Rico. It has roughly 90,000 inhabitants, plus a floating population of ~15,000, on weekdays, particularly when the University of Puerto Rico at Mayagüez is not in recess. Mayagüez is known as " La Sultana del Oeste " (the sultana of the West). Founded in 1760 by Faustino Martínez de Matos, Juan de Silva and Juan de Aponte. Originally named " Our Lady of the Candelaria of Mayagüez ", but dwindling tradition from the Indian name of its river, the Yagüez River … Bernie B.
